The key will be ready quickly and will usually be less than buying it from the dealer. Transponder Keys The key that was in your car when it was purchased most likely has a chip within. These chips transmit an low-level signal when the key is near the ignition or door lock. This allows the car to identify that it is the right key, and it will then turn or unlock the door as required. The majority of cars built since 1995 have transponder keys installed in them. Transponder keys are an additional layer to safeguard your vehicle from theft. Transponder keys can't be copied by any locksmith. They require special equipment. If you don't own an original one, it's not possible to find an exact copy without the help of a professional locksmith or dealer. Smart Keys Many car manufacturers including Toyota and its luxury division Lexus are now providing smart keys that allow you to unlock the car door to turn off the engine and lock it without the need to use keys that are physically held. These keys are becoming more popular due to their ease of use. These devices are more akin to the card you would find in a wallet instead of a key and they can be programmed so that they unlock, open, and even start your vehicle when you are within a certain distance. They are secure against theft since they don't send the same frequency signal in a row. This is a way to prevent tech-savvy thieves from getting hold of your key and using its identification. Instead, the computer in the vehicle examines the code projected by the key and confirms it is the right one for your vehicle prior to allowing the key to operate the ignition.
